A Purple Parakeet in Watercolor.
On my purple kick this past weekend, I created a random splash of color and topped it with cling wrap to create an abstract design.
I often like to do this when I don’t have anything special in mind to paint, but just want to create! Then I look at it – sometimes for days or longer – until I see something appear.
My oldest DIL and I were at a local event this past Saturday at Quality Gardens and Bloom Cafe in Valencia, PA with our McKinneyX2Designs art and signs, and a man asked me if I ever painted a parakeet.
I hadn’t ever thought to, but when I looked at my “blob” of paint the next day, a parakeet appeared! Mind over matter??!!
So I painted this. I don’t even know the man’s name (who sweetly purchased a copy each of Klaus the Mouse, and Lucas the Lucky Lion for his grown artist daughter), but this painting is lovingly dedicated to him wherever he is, in honor of the sweet parakeet he and his wife recently loved and lost. May they somehow feel the love. And if he ever sees this, I will surely gift him with a print!
